Stuart Broad IPL Career: A Slow Start

Stuart Broad was first picked up by the Kolkata Knight Riders in the inaugural IPL season in 2008. However, he never got a chance to play in the tournament due to England’s busy international schedule. It wasn’t until 2011 when Kings XI Punjab bought him for a whopping ₹1.84 crore that he finally got a chance to play in the IPL. However, his debut season was cut short due to a calf injury, and he could only play nine matches, taking eight wickets at an average of 27.25.

The following year, Kings XI Punjab retained Broad for ₹2.1 crore, but he once again missed the entire season due to injury. Since then, Broad has not been picked by any IPL team, and he hasn’t played a single match in the tournament.

Why Hasn’t Stuart Broad Played in the IPL?

There are several reasons why Stuart Broad hasn’t played much in the IPL. One of the main reasons is his busy international schedule. Broad is a regular member of the England cricket team and is often playing for his country during the IPL season. The IPL is also a high-intensity tournament, and injuries are common. Broad has had his fair share of injuries throughout his career, and this has also played a role in his limited IPL appearances.

Another reason is the nature of the IPL auction. The IPL auction is a highly competitive and unpredictable event, and many talented players miss out on being picked by a team. In Broad’s case, his high base price may have been a deterrent for teams looking to save money and build a balanced squad. Teams are also often looking for players who can perform multiple roles, such as all-rounders or specialist T20 bowlers, and Broad’s lack of T20 experience may have worked against him.

Stuart Broad’s T20 Record

While Stuart Broad may not have played much in the IPL, he has a respectable T20 record overall. He has played 121 T20 matches and has taken 157 wickets at an average of 25.20 and an economy rate of 7.86. He has also scored over 700 runs in T20s at a strike rate of 136.99. Broad’s T20 record shows that he is more than capable of performing in the shortest format of the game, and it’s surprising that he hasn’t played more in the IPL.
